|
CATIA V5 Programmierung : Zugriff auf Rauhigkeitssymbole im Makro
Maetes am 20.05.2010 um 17:14 Uhr (0)
Hab diesbezüglich folgendes gefunden: http://catiadoc.free.fr/online/French/interfaces/interface_roughness.htm#Applicability Aber wo liegt die Klasse? Mit Anyobjekt kann ich nix anfangen -_-Der Zugriff selber geht sehr gut über die Suchenfunktion. Aber das erstellen? Also folgendes funktioniert nicht?CATIA.ActiveDocument.Sheets.ActiveSheet.Views.ActiveView.Roughness.SetField[Diese Nachricht wurde von Maetes am 20. Mai. 2010 editiert.]
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Allgemein : Langloch effizient messen?
Maetes am 25.01.2010 um 19:54 Uhr (0)
Hallo miteinander!Gibt es in Catia eine Möglichkeit Langlöcher sicher zu vermessen?Im speziellen geht es mir um das CATPart selber. Nicht das Drawing.Bis dato hab ich immer den Durchmesser und dann den Abstand zwischen den beiden Halbkreisen gemessen. Gibt es da keine fertige Funktion für?Die bisherige Arbeitsweise ist natürlich sehr Fehleranfällig, da man z.B. Durchmesser mit Radius verwechseln könnte und so beim zusammenaddieren völlig falsche Werte rausbekommt.Vielleicht kennt ihr da was sinnvolles?Grus ...
|
| In das Form CATIA V5 Allgemein wechseln |
|
CATIA V5 Programmierung : CATIA.StartCommand = New... geht nicht?
Maetes am 30.11.2010 um 16:24 Uhr (0)
Es ging mir ja darum, wenn schon das Fenster kommt, das ich es dann selber aufrufen kann und dann via {down}{down}{enter}{enter} quasi das Product auswähle und das Fenster schliesse.Interessanterweise funktioniert es jetzt wieder mit dem speichern. Wo das Problem jetzt lag kann ich schwer sagen Mit Quellcode ist in dieser Situation bez schwierig, weil das Programm mehrere Schleifen in verschiedenen Modulen durchläuft. ich versuche wo möglich schon Quellcode freizugeben. Aber in dem Fall wars bez schwierig. ...
|
| In das Form CATIA V5 Programmierung wechseln |
|
Pro ENGINEER : PRO/TOOLKIT - Wie anfangen?
Maetes am 28.10.2009 um 14:37 Uhr (0)
Hallo miteinander!Wir sind bei uns am überlegen auf Pro/E zu wechseln.Dazu werden wir die nächste Woche mit ein paar Tests anfangen - unter anderem auch die Programmierschnittstelle.Hab mich diesbezüglich einwenig eingelesen und komme da irgendwie nicht weiter (Suchfunktion im Forum tut wiedermal nicht).So wie ich mitbekommen habe gibt es ja unter anderem dieses TOOLKIT, mit dem man am meisten Möglichkeiten hat. Des weiteren hab ich gelesen, das Pro/E ab der 4er Version eine Microsoft VBA-Schnittstelle hat ...
|
| In das Form Pro ENGINEER wechseln |
|
CATIA V5 Allgemein : Darstellung Höhenmeter einer Begrenzung
Maetes am 14.08.2009 um 15:53 Uhr (0)
Hallo miteinander!Habe eine Frage. Und zwar kennt ihr sicher die Höhenmeteranzeige bei Radrennen: http://www.fahrrad-tour.de/Jakobsradweg/Bilder/Hoehenmeter9.jpg In der die ganze Strecke auf eine 2D Grafik komprimiert wird.Gibt es diese Möglichkeit auch in Catia?Dabei soll der Abstand der Aussenbegrenzung eines Blechs zu einer Ebene auf eine 2D Ansicht "ausgeklappt werden".Theoretisch hätte ich die Möglichkeit mit Hilfer einer Projekion die Linien einzeln hoch zu ziehen, aber dies wäre selbst mit einem Mak ...
|
| In das Form CATIA V5 Allgemein wechseln |
|
CATIA V5 Drafting : Tabellen ohne Rahmen
Maetes am 13.04.2010 um 09:41 Uhr (0)
Hallo miteinander!Ich suche nach einer Möglichkeit Tabellen mit unsichtbaren Rahmen zu erstellen.Hab dies bezüglich auch einige Beiträge gefunden, allerdings sind diese älter. Vllt gibt es mittlerweile bessere Alternativen?Die Einstellung die Linien auf weiss zu stellen und dann den Text schwarz zu färben funktioniert. Beim ausdrucken mit der Einstellung Weiss nciht schwarz drucken funktioniert auch.Allerdings ignoriert Catia diese Einstellung, wenn man das Drawing als PDF speichern (nicht drucken) möchte. ...
|
| In das Form CATIA V5 Drafting wechseln |
|
CATIA V5 Programmierung : CATIA & Dateiname bzw. Dateiendung auslesen
Maetes am 10.08.2010 um 14:24 Uhr (0)
Anhand des Dateityps wird man in den Tools entsprechend weitergeleitet bzw. werden Standard Klassen vorgeladen.Des Weiteren habe ich ein Tool zur Stapelverarbeitung z.B. zur Datenkonvertierung, da ist dann praktisch, wenn man dann gewisse Dateiformate im Vorfeld ausklammern kann./edit:Ok ich probiers jetzt erstmal auf dem Weg:Lese Dateinamen aus windows.caption, wenn Dateiendung fehlt (z.B. weils nicht gespeichert wurde), schaue unter parents, da steht dann der Dateityp im Catiaformat (Sprich igs und stp w ...
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: ExportData igs stp
Maetes am 22.11.2010 um 15:22 Uhr (0)
Hallo zusammen!Habe ein kleines Script mit dem ich einfach Dateien umkonvertieren kann. Was soweit auch funktioniert:catpart - igsigs - catpartstp - catpartcatpart - stpaber isg - stp geht nicht. Wieso? Muss ich erst als catpart speichern oder wo liegt das Problem?Sub Test() Set FSO = CreateObject("Scripting.FileSystemObject") MySource = "C:" MyTarget = "C:" MyFile = "test.stp" MyFilter = "igs" Set ActDocs = CATIA.Documents Set SelDoc = ActDocs.Open(MySource & MyFile) MsgBox ...
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ia Version eines Dokuments
Maetes am 24.08.2009 um 15:46 Uhr (0)
Hallo!Hab in letzter Zeit auch so meine Probleme mit Dateiversionen und finde die Lösung mit dem findstr sehr gut!Nun wollte ich die Sache vereinfachen und hab ein kleines Windowsprogramm geschrieben. Allerdings gibt er mir mit findstr keine Ausgabe aus?Hat jemand eine Idee woran das liegt?Hier der Code (auf das Minimum reduziert)Code:Set WShell = CreateObject("WScript.Shell")Set Command = WShell.Exec("findstr CATIAV5 " & WScript.Arguments.Item(0))MsgBox Command.StdOut.ReadAlländere ich ""findstr CATIAV5 " ...
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Englischbezeichnung für Kurve für SelectElement2
Maetes am 13.07.2009 um 18:12 Uhr (0)
Hab beim rumprobieren gesehen, das Catia diese Ecken ich glaub Schnittpunkte nannte. Sprich Vertex und voila damit gings. Soweit ich weiss, hat er Curve eben nicht genommen. Wär ja auch zu einfach gewesen =)Habs jetzt so gemacht:Code:SelElements(0) = "Vertex"UserSel = ActDoc.Selection.SelectElement2(SelElements, "Bla", True)If UserSel = "Normal" Then Set Ref1 = Selection.Item(1).Reference Selection.ClearEnd IfUserSel = ActDoc.Selection.SelectElement2(SelElements, "Bla", True)If UserSel = "Normal" The ...
|
| In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Ableitung einer Seite durch Teilfläche (Tangentenstetig)
Maetes am 23.06.2009 um 17:44 Uhr (0)
Hallo miteinander. Habs jetzt soweit auch selber geschafft, mit Hilfe der Makroaufzeichnung eine Ableitung mit durch selektieren einer Teilfläche und eingestellter Tangentenfunktion zu erstellen.Nun will ich keinen festen Wert zum abgreifen, sondern eine Eingabe durch den User erreichen.Habs mir erstmal einfach machen wollen mit CreateReferenceFromGeometry, aber es kann anscheinend nichts mit Teilflächen anfangen Jetzt in den sauren Apfel gebissen versuche ich über CreateReferenceFromBRepName an meine Tei ...
|
| In das Form CATIA V5 Programmierung wechseln |